The NATO Innovation Fund empowers founders to addresschallenges inDefence, Security, and Resilience, and secure the future of the Dealroom partners closely with local tech ecosystem development agenciesand enablers, to create a comprehensive multi-dimensional blueprint of thetech ecosystem, including capital, talent, innovation, entrepreneurship and Key focus areas The NATO Innovation Fund invests in emerging disruptive technology areasincludingartificial intelligence(AI),autonomy,quantum,biotechnology,hypersonic systems, space, novel materials and manufacturing, energy and Key Takeaways Revenue, exits andcollaborations Overall market trends Regional trends Thematic trends ●The UK and Germany lead in DSRinvesting with Finland, Spain, Norwayand Bulgaria on the rise.●The UK attracted the most VC fundingin 2025 with $2.9B.Germany is closingthe gap with $2.1B.●Finland notably ranked 4th by DSRfunding in 2025and lead among theNordics with $636M raised.●Germany and the Netherlands havethe highest share of VC funding goingto DSRin 2025 at over 15% each.●Central and Eastern Europe showedthe fastest growth in deal velocity,with a 2.7x increase since 2020 led byBulgariaʼs EnduroSat space technology ●Security of critical technologies sawstrongest growth across all stageswhile defence challenge areas also grewstrongly at early and late stage.●Energy security and resilience sawnegative growth across all stages●AIunderpinned 44% of DSR funding in2025, the highest share in the last 6years.●VC funding in the sub-area ofAwareness, Understanding andDecision Makingreached a record ●Venture Capital (VC) funding inEuropean Deep Tech Defence, Securityand Resilience (DSR) is at an all timehighreaching $8.7B in 2025.●Funding is up 55% from last year,nearly 4 times higher than 5 years ago.●43% of all European Deep Tech VCfunding went into DSR in 2025. Thisrepresented 13% of all VC funding, up 3xin the last 3 years.●Late-stage mega-funding is drivingthis growthby tripling from last year to$4.7B driven by mega rounds in AI & ●Data shows early signs that startups areaccessing capital, generating revenueand fostering partnerships as thesectorʼs growth cements Europeʼstechnological sovereignty●Increasing evidence DSR startups arebuildingstrategic and financialpartnerships with defence primeswhilst also winning public tenders●While VC financing is predominant The European Deep Tech Defence, Security and Resilience landscape in a snapshot $8.7B +55%Growth in VC funding year-over-year 13% Share of total VC in Europe going toDefence, Security and Resilience startups In VC funding raised by European Defence,Security and Resilience startups in 2025. …while the overall VC market grew by only 16%.4x growth for DSR in the last five years.
